Clearblue Advanced Digital Ovulation Test typically identifies 4 or more fertile days (1). By accurately tracking 2 key fertility hormones, estrogen and luteinising hormone, this ovulation test identifies 2 peak fertility days, but also additional high fertility days before that. This means you have more opportunities to get pregnant - at least twice as many as with any other ovulation test (1). Unlike basal body temperature (BBT) charting, ovulation predictor kits detect the rise in luteinising hormone (LH) that rises prior to ovulation to accurately detect the day BEFORE, and day of ovulation. Unlike other ovulation tests which track LH only, Clearblue Advanced Digital Ovulation Test also detects estrogen, which rises prior to the LH surge to detect more fertile days. The digital display gives you a Clearblue smiley face when it identifies your best days to get pregnant. Advanced Digital Ovulation Test:Always read the manufacturer’s instructions for any medication you are taking before testing.You may get misleading results if you are taking fertility drugs containing luteinising hormone (LH) or human Chorionic Gonadotrophin, or are taking antibiotic containing tetracyclines. Some fertility treatments such as clomiphene citrate may give misleading High Fertility results but Peak Fertility results should not be affected.If you have recently stopped using hormonal contraception your cycles may be irregular so you may wish to wait until you have had 2 cycles before testing.As prenatal care is very important for a baby’s health, we recommend that you consult your doctor before you try to conceive. Check with your doctor if you are taking any medication or have any medical condition before planning a pregnancy. If you have a medically diagnosed fertility problem, ask your doctor if this test is suitable for you and if you do get unexpected results discuss them with your doctor.If you are under 35 years and haven’t become pregnant, we recommend you see your doctor after 12 months. If you’re over 35 years see your doctor if you haven’t become pregnant after 6 months, and straight away if you are over 40.This IVD digital device meets the missions and immunity requirements of EN 61326-2-6. Medications containing hCG, and certain rare medical conditions, can cause false positive results. Ectopic or recent pregnancy, even if not carried to full term, can cause misleading results. If you are in or approaching the menopause you may obtain a false pregnant result even though you are not pregnant. The test should NOT be affected by hormone therapies containing Clomiphene citrate, common painkillers, alcohol, antibiotics, or the contraceptive pill.
